Compilation of my borzoi, Teddy, growing from 2 weeks old to 7 months old

This is the first puppy I've ever own and raised on my own. I got him when he was 8 weeks old. Borzois have always been a dream dog of mine, since I grew up with an adopted greyhound and fell in love with sighthounds. He is turning into such a beautiful dog. My breeder recommended that I show him, but I don't think I have the resources or time to put him in an actual show, so I'll show him off here for now.

I have been really surprised by the differences between my previous greyhound and Teddy. I'm not sure if it's because he's still in his puppy stage or just a personality difference-- nothing bad, but I really thought he would be nearly the same as my other dog. I think it's made the experience even more fun. He still has about 30 lbs to gain! He is currently around 65 lbs and his sire is 88 lbs.

Thank you both for the kind words. It's going to be difficult, but I'll manage somehow.
The shelter had her as part Chow and apparently they're more susceptible to gastric cancer, which is extremely aggressive and often shows no symptoms until it's already spread and advanced too far for any kind of treatment. I wish I would've known this from the start, but again the symptoms were so mild at the beginning the very idea of cancer would've seemed crazy to me. It's cruel and unfair and just difficult to even comprehend.

      Hi ! Does anyone have any experience with age spots in dogs ? Or could recommend if I should be concerned and schedule a visit with my vet or not ??
      Hazel is 5 years old . Recently ( within this month ) I noticed black spots seemingly appear on her belly/underside area . I was concerned for a bit but she shows no other symptoms aside from the new pigmentation . Money is tight rn due to finishing up heartworm treatment and other non dog related life things .
      Googling revealed plenty of scary theories of course but also mentioned age spots . Since she isn't showing any symptoms to the other diseases black spots on the skin accompany I've chalked it up to age spots for the past couple days . The spots seems to have gotten darker ( and possibly spread ????? ) so I am more concerned again .

      I just curios for opinions before I go over the top and make a vet appointment and kill the bank accounts again . I don't wanna overreact ya know ?

      @nervousdog you might've already read this yourself, but heres a pretty good article on it. and here's someone who wrote about their dogs having the issue (they called the vet and included what the vet said).

      main jist i get from googling is that hyperpigmentation is a result of another issue, most commonly skin allergies. im not a vet so i definitely don't want to give medical advice, but since you mentioned a tight bank account i just wanted to reassure you that this most likely isn't a life-threatening issue. especially since your dog is acting normal otherwise!

      still, if you notice that you can't sleep easy at night because you're worrying about it, give your vet a call! the cost will be worth the peace of mind in that case.
